Examining Cell and Gene Therapies

Genetic interventions and cell-based treatments represent two unique but often interconnected disciplines of clinical revolution:

✅ Cell Therapy entails the introduction, adjustment, or infusion of biological cells into a host to manage a malady. This includes hematopoietic cell therapy, engineered immune cell therapy for tumorous growths, and tissue repair techniques to rehabilitate affected organs.

✅ Gene Therapy aims at correcting or replacing genetic abnormalities within a subject’s genetic material to remedy DNA-related diseases. This is carried out through targeted gene transport that introduce therapeutic sequences into the cellular environment.

These therapies are leading a groundbreaking phase where conditions that were once managed with chronic drug regimens or invasive procedures could realistically be eliminated with a curative solution.


Biological Delivery Systems

Microbes have developed to effectively introduce genetic material into host cells, making them an effective tool for genetic modification. Widely used viral vectors consist of:

Adenoviral vectors – Designed to invade both mitotic and static cells but can elicit immune responses.

Parvovirus-based carriers – Preferred due to their lower immunogenicity and ability to sustain prolonged DNA transcription.

Retroviruses and Lentiviruses – Integrate into the cellular DNA, providing stable gene expression, with lentiviruses being particularly beneficial for altering dormant cellular structures.

Alternative Genetic Delivery Methods

Synthetic genetic modification approaches offer a reduced-risk option, diminishing adverse immunogenic effects. These encompass:

Lipid-based carriers and nano-delivery systems – Coating nucleic acids for targeted internalization.

Electrical Permeabilization – Applying electric shocks to create temporary pores in biological enclosures, allowing genetic material to enter.

Intramuscular Gene Delivery – Introducing genetic material directly into specific organs.

Applications of Gene Therapy

DNA-based interventions have proven effective across multiple medical fields, profoundly influencing the treatment of inherited conditions, malignancies, and viral conditions.

Treatment of Genetic Disorders

Various hereditary diseases stem from single-gene mutations, rendering them suitable targets for DNA-based intervention. Key developments include:

Cystic Fibrosis – Research aiming to incorporate working CFTR sequences indicate potential efficacy.

Clotting Factor Deficiency – Gene therapy trials focus on regenerating the generation of hemostatic molecules.

Dystrophic Muscle Disorders – CRISPR-driven genetic correction provides potential for DMD-affected individuals.

Hemoglobinopathies and Erythrocyte Disorders – Genomic treatment approaches seek to repair oxygen transport mutations.

DNA-Based Oncology Solutions

Gene therapy plays a vital role in cancer treatment, either by altering T-cell functionality to eliminate cancerous growths or by reprogramming malignant cells to halt metastasis. Key innovative oncogenetic treatments consist of:

Chimeric Antigen Receptor T-Cell Engineering – Reprogrammed immune cells attacking tumor markers.

Cancer-Selective Viral Agents – Bioengineered viral entities that exclusively invade and destroy tumor cells.

Reactivation of Oncogene Inhibitors – Restoring the function of genes like TP53 to control proliferation.


Care of Pathogenic Diseases

Genetic treatment provides possible remedies for chronic diseases exemplified by viral immunodeficiency. Trial-phase approaches encompass:

CRISPR-Based HIV Therapy – Targeting and destroying HIV-infected tissues.

DNA Alteration of T Cells – Rendering T cells immune to pathogen infiltration.

Exploring the Mechanisms of Cell and Gene Therapy

Cell Therapy: Utilizing Regenerative Cellular Potential

Regenerative approaches capitalizes on the healing capacity of human tissues for therapeutic intervention. Key instances involve:

Hematopoietic Stem Cell Grafts:
Used to restore blood cell function in patients through renewal of blood-forming cells via matched cellular replacements.

CAR-T Immunotherapy: A transformative malignancy-fighting method in which a person’s white blood cells are enhanced to detect and attack and combat malignant cells.

MSC Therapy: Explored for its potential in managing autoimmune-related illnesses, orthopedic injuries, and neurodegenerative disorders.

Genetic Engineering Solutions: Restructuring the Fundamental Biology

Gene therapy works by repairing the fundamental issue of genetic diseases:

Direct Genetic Therapy: Delivers modified genes directly into the biological structure, such as the regulatory-approved vision-restoring Luxturna for managing inherited blindness.

External Genetic Modification: Utilizes reprogramming a biological samples externally and then implanting them, as applied in some clinical trials for hemoglobinopathy conditions and immune deficiencies.

The advent of gene-editing CRISPR has rapidly progressed gene therapy research, making possible targeted alterations at the fundamental coding.

Transformative Applications in Medicine

Cell and gene therapies are advancing treatment paradigms in various specialties:

Tumor Therapies

The sanction of CAR-T cell therapies like Kymriah and Gilead’s Yescarta has changed the landscape of cancer treatment, with significant impact on cancer sufferers with refractory hematologic diseases who have no viable remaining treatments.

Genomic Conditions

Conditions for instance a genetic neuromuscular disorder as well as SCD, that historically offered minimal therapeutic choices, at present possess innovative gene navigate here therapy solutions including Zolgensma and a cutting-edge genetic correction method.
